Day 4 Colmar to Beaune

Another day of clear sunny skies and warm temperatures--up to 33 degrees today. Set out after another fabulous breakfast beside the pool and headed to another little village on the Route du Vin called Eguisheim--very picturesque. Bought bread and kiwi in the market for lunch and headed towards Beaune in the heart of the Burgundy region. Toured the Hotel Dieu, a hospital built in the 1400's and still used until the 1980's! Next we toured an incredible wine cellar (Jim you would love this!) It was an underground labyrinth stocked with countless thousands of bottles. We were able to sample 13 of them. Found our hotel--very cute--then had a very French dinner, complete with creme brûlée. No such thing as low fat on that menu!
